Emily Atack wants 'Hollyoaks' role

The Inbetweeners actress, who is currently in ITV1's Dancing on Ice, apparently thinks that she will be suited to the more "racy" storylines.
She told the Daily Star Sunday: "I have no idea what is happening in the future with The Inbetweeners. All we know is that we are filming this series now.
"It is probably wise for the show to go out on a high while people are still really enjoying it, rather than making so many that people get bored.
"If it does end I wouldn't mind a part in Hollyoaks - the storylines are always very racy so it would definitely suit me!"
The 20-year-old's comments come amid fears of a mass cull from new producer Paul Marquess, known for axing cast members during stints at The Bill and Five soap Family Affairs.
Lucy Allan quit as leading producer of Hollyoaks earlier in the month.
